DXS-3400 Series Lite Layer 3 Stackable 10GbE Managed Switch Web UI Reference Guide Parameter Policy Name Limit Address Count Protocol VID List Description Enter the IPv6 snooping policy name used here. This name can be up to 32 characters long. Enter the address count limit value used here. This value must be between 0 and 511. Tick the No Limit option to disable this option. Select the protocol state here. Options to choose from are Enabled and Disabled. Select DHCP to associate the DHCP protocol with this policy. Select NDP to associate the NDP protocol with this policy. DHCPv6 Snooping sniffs the DHCPv6 packets sent between the DHCPv6 client and server in the address assigning procedure. When a DHCPv6 client successfully got a valid IPv6 address, DHCPv6 snooping creates its binding database. ND Snooping is designed for a stateless auto-configuration assigned IPv6 address and manually configured IPv6 address. Before assigning an IPv6 address, the host must perform Duplicate Address Detection first. ND snooping detects DAD messages (DAD Neighbor Solicitation (NS) and DAD Neighbor Advertisement (NA)) to build its binding database. The NDP packet (NS and NA) is also used to detect whether a host is still reachable and determine whether to delete a binding or not. Enter the VLAN ID list used here. IPv6 ND Inspection This window is used to display and configure the IPv6 ND inspection settings. To view the following window, click Security > IMPB > IPv6 >IPv6 ND Inspection, as shown below: Figure 9-57IPv6 ND Inspection Window The fields that can be configured are described below: Parameter Policy Name Device Role Validate Source-MAC Description Enter the policy name used here. This name can be up to 32 characters long. Select the device role here. Options to choose from are Host and Router. By default, the device's role is set as host and inspection for NS and NA messages are performed. If the device role is set as router, the NS and NA inspection is not performed. When performing NS/NA inspection, the message will be verified against the dynamic binding table learned from the ND protocol or from the DHCP. Select to enable or disable the validation of the source MAC address option here. When the Switch receives an ND message that contains a link-layer address, the source MAC address is checked against the link-layer address.
